The moment finally captured !
[caption id="" align="aligncenter" width="384" caption="Ant transfering Wax obtained from mealy bugs"]
[caption id="" align="aligncenter" width="280" caption="Ants transfering was obtained from mealy bugs"]
So what is happening there ?
Well these ants obtain some wax produced by mealy bug (those white things in picture) in exchange ants provide security to the bugs. This happens in monsoon season.
Philosophy
I was surprised to observe this whole system of ants society. And i was amazed to see many things which i missed to shoot. It was amazing demonstration of management !
How i got them ?
I used historic 50mm Yashica lens in reverse on my sony cybershot H5 camera. Focus was set to infinity and focus was acheived by moving back and forth. Lens was tapped infront of the camera. Do not be surprised this technique is been around for quite some time.

Capturing flow of water
Click images to see full galleries
[caption id="" align="aligncenter" width="400" caption="Canon 18-55 f/3.2-5.6 lens at f/8 at 18mm"]
[caption id="" align="aligncenter" width="400" caption="EF-s 17-85 mm at f32 "]
The Technique
Before any body asks here is what i did to sucessfully capture these images.
To capture flowing water you got to have set your camera for slow shutter settings. I used canon Kit Lens 18-55 at f/8 and f/11. I had 58mm ND 8 Sony filter on it to stop down the light. Keep shutter speed lower then 1/8, 1/6 sec. The last one was shot at 13 sec with kit lens. If you don't have an ND filter wait till sun goes down and very little light of day is left, this may give focusing tough time so becareful with focusing.

North of Pakistan is Beautiful !!
Well after long time i got chance to visit northern areas of Pakistan. Kaghan, Naran, Lake saif al Malook and Lalazar. Places are full of beauty and traveling over there is amazingly easy. I will highly recommend you to spend your next vacations over there. Perfect place for camping and hiking.
If you love life i am sorry to say roads are very dangerous if you are planning to go to Lalazar. But good news is that you can hike and camp over there !. Main road which bring you to Naran and Kaghan valley is very good for even large cars and jeeps. On Lalazar's jeep track only small light jeeps can pass through.
If you are small group it is much better and easy if you chose local transport to Naran, Where you can spend a night in a hotel oryou can camp there. From Naran there is no shortage of Jeeps and driver on rent, they will take you to Lake saif al malook and Lalazar one day is sufficient to see both places. I spent 2500 Rs or 40$ for 3 days including jeep rent, food and traveling expenses from and to Islamabad. these exclude hotel i got lucky and found good place to sleep.
If you are a Photographer
Well as most of you know i am one crazy photographer more then anything else. I will highly recommend you to have loads of memory cards and battery !!. I lost many photos as my battery fully drained in middle of the day. And had to delete a lot photos which i loved to clear memory.
I was loaded with Canon 18-55 kit lens, My buddy was loaded with 70-200 f/4L IS. I will recommend you to bag wide lens and telephoto 70-200 range you will enjoy it. It is wise to have good protective bag for your gear because drive won't be smooth and air won't be dust free. I bagged few polythene bags as well.
When to Visit
June July or August anywhere in these 3 months is considered best time. You should have jacket as it was really freezing in the morning.
